🎉 HUGE WIN! We got Mayor Parker to reverse course and save Philly’s Zero Fare Program & SEPTA Key Advantage benefit for city workers! Thank you to our 650+ petition signers and partners at @transit4philly.bsky.social and CM O’Rourke’s office!!

Mayor Cherelle Parker has abandoned her plan to slash subsidized SEPTA fare programs following criticism

The Zero Fare program provides SEPTA access for low-income residents, and the Key Advantage program pays for fares for city employees.
